Zig Zag Wire Chairs Made in Italy 1970

About the Item

Very nice and unusual set of 6 'zig zag' chairs made by unknown manufacturer in Italy, 1970. The chairs are made of solid metal wire frames, supported by a metal strip on the size to provide support. This strip is also visually very appealing to the design of these chairs. The chairs are okay from the comfort, a small cushion would probably improve the comfort. Since the seat tilts a bit backwards, they have a dynamic shape. The chairs are most likely inspired by the famous Zig Zag chair by Gerrit Rietveld, which was already designed in the 1930s. These chairs are produced in the 1970s. These chairs are also stackable for easy storing. The condition of the chairs is still amazing, with minor signs of wear and usage, which is pretty unusual for chairs this age. The chairs are priced and sold in a set of 6.

  • Zig Zag Chair by Gerrit Rietveld for Cassina, 1970s
    By Gerrit Rietveld, Cassina
    Located in Antwerp, BE
    'Zig Zag Chair,' originally designed by Gerrit Thomas Rietveld in 1934 and relaunched by Cassina in Italy in 1973 and 2011. This contemporary edition features striking red with white sides, emphasizing the interplay of vertical, oblique, and horizontal lines. With its innovative cantilevered design, the chair consists of four wood boards intricately joined to create a visually captivating yet unstable structure. Departing from traditional seating arrangements, Rietveld crafted a ribbon-like form resembling a 'Z'. Cassina's expert carpenters showcased their skill through precise dove-tail joints, enhancing the chair's aesthetic appeal. This colored wooden lacquer version is one of several variations by Rietveld. One available and in perfect condition. Gerrit Thomas Rietveld (24 June 1888 – 25 June 1964) was a Dutch furniture designer and architect. One of the principal members of the Dutch artistic movement called De Stijl, Rietveld is famous for his red and blue chair and for the Rietveld Schröder House...
